Ange Postecoglou Optimistic About Mathys Tel's Future at Tottenham

Posted on February 06, 2025

Tottenham Hotspur manager Ange Postecoglou has expressed strong confidence that Mathys Tel will remain with the club beyond his loan spell from Bayern Munich. The young forward, who joined Spurs on a temporary basis with a £45 million option for a permanent transfer, has caught the attention of Postecoglou, who emphasized that he did not bring Tel in for just six months. The 19-year-old is expected to play a significant role in the team's ambitions this season, especially with key injuries impacting the squad.

Tel’s move to Tottenham came after a dramatic change of heart, where he initially rejected the club before being convinced by Postecoglou's vision and assurances about his playing time. The manager stated, "He will be a Tottenham player. I think he will show everyone he will be a Tottenham player in the next six months." Postecoglou is keen on integrating Tel into various attacking roles, as injuries have left Spurs short on options, particularly in the forward positions.

As Spurs prepare for their Carabao Cup semi-final against Liverpool, both Tel and fellow new signing Kevin Danso are available for selection. Postecoglou highlighted the versatility of Tel, who can operate as a center forward or on the wings, providing much-needed depth to a squad currently managing several injury issues. With Tel set to make his debut soon, fans can look forward to seeing how the young talent will contribute to Tottenham's campaign moving forward.
